## Service Accounts: Queryforge Planner Diagnostics

Following the query planner regression in Queryforge 3.2, a temporary service account was provisioned so the diagnostics harness can replay production plans against the internal plan-capture service. Security reviewers should note the account is read-only, scoped to the replay namespace, and slated for removal once the regression fix ships. Access is logged per request and audited weekly. For completeness of this review, the credential currently in use by the harness is recorded below.

service key, kajep-tajof: vxb15-JbkY2CEB1X0jNz8

Meeting notes, records sync, Wednesday. Discussed the three bronze figures on loan from the Westhollow Collection ahead of the Quillbrook show. Condition reports are complete and filed; crating by Arden Fine Art Services is booked for Friday. Records team to log crate numbers against the loan agreement on collection day. The confidential courier hand-over instruction for this movement appears directly below.

handover note for yagef-bagep: the drudor pelius courier leaves the kasdor zorvan norir ledger at gate 8016 under passcode 755406

// Loyalty ledger constants for the Thistlecart points system.
// Quick context for the eng sync: every earn/burn event lands in the
// append-only ledger, and these knobs control batching, expiry sweeps,
// and the reconciliation window. We bumped the sweep interval last
// quarter after the Harborlane backlog scare. The values currently
// shipped to production are the following.

tuning constants:
QUOTAS = {
    "druwyn": 5,
    "holix": 5,
    "zorath": 5,
    "holwyn": 10,
}

### Ticket: Digest scheduler needs sign-off

Hey reviewer — this wires up batch email digests in Mailloft so they fire at 06:00 local per tenant instead of one global cron blast. I added jitter to avoid hammering the queue and a dry-run flag for staging. Tests pass, and the Quillbrook pilot tenants are opted in. Before merge, this needs a formal sign-off from the scheduling owner.

approver of yawig-yajef = Briius Jorix